About Trina

Trina Fraser has a broad business law background but is best known as head of the firm's CannaLaw group and a leading practitioner in cannabis law in Canada. The Chambers Canada guide has ranked her a Band 1 lawyer in Cannabis Law since 2019, and she has been listed in The Best Lawyers in Canada for Cannabis Law each year since 2020. She was named Cannabis Lawyer of the Year at the 2024 GrowUp Industry Awards Gala, Attorney of the Year at the 2019 O'Cannabiz Industry Awards Gala, and one of Canadian Lawyer Magazine's Top 25 Most Influential Lawyers in 2019. She represents licensed cannabis cultivators, processors, medical sellers, nurseries, analytical testers, researchers and retailers, advising on licensing, security clearance, promotion and compliance issues, and on change-of-control and B2B commercial matters. Trina is a registered trademark agent. She earned her Bachelor of Commerce and Juris Doctor at Queen's University, and serves on the board of the Snowsuit Fund as Secretary and Past Chairperson.
